Windmills are generally located on higher elevations or mounds in an attempt to better capture the wind. The higher the windmill is constructed off the ground, the more wind can be caught to turn the blades and thus create energy.
Higher elevations are colder than lower elevations because the air pressure decreases with altitude, causing the air to expand and cool. This results in lower temperatures at higher elevations.

The Cumberland Plateau generally has higher elevations than the Edwards Plateau. The Cumberland Plateau, located in the eastern United States, features elevations that can exceed 2,000 feet, while the Edwards Plateau in Texas typically ranges from about 1,200 to 2,000 feet. Therefore, in terms of average and maximum elevations, the Cumberland Plateau is the higher of the two.
